AI Is Changing How Marketers Reach Customers
This piece from Digiday talks about how AI is shaking things up in the advertising world, especially for creative teams. Basically, marketers have spent years perfecting how they measure if their ads are actually working. They use all sorts of clever tools to figure out who sees what, what leads to a sale, and how to get the most bang for their buck. They've built complex systems to track everything from which ads people click on to how different marketing efforts combine to make a customer buy something.
Now, artificial intelligence — that's software that can learn and make decisions — is coming into play. AI is really good at finding patterns in huge amounts of data. This means it can quickly analyse all that advertising information and spot what works, and more importantly, what doesn't. Instead of marketers manually tweaking campaigns, AI can suggest or even make changes on the fly to improve how ads perform.
The real insight here is that while we've been very good at measuring the *effect* of advertising, generative AI (the kind that can create new text, images or videos) is highlighting that we might not be as good at creating the ads themselves. AI can generate loads of different ad variations in moments, and then quickly test them to see which ones grab people's attention best. This means the creative side of advertising needs to catch up, focusing more on big, unique ideas that AI can then help refine and deliver.
For businesses, this means advertising could become much more efficient and effective. Imagine being able to try out hundreds of different ad taglines or images almost instantly, and knowing which ones are most likely to resonate with your customers. It’s less about guessing what will work and more about data-driven decisions, potentially saving money and making your marketing budget go further. It changes the game for how brands connect with their audience.
Why it matters
For small business owners, this means your advertising can become smarter and more targeted. AI tools, even simple ones, could help you understand what ads genuinely attract customers, potentially saving you cash and making your marketing efforts much more fruitful.
